怎么做saas技术部署(saas平台技术搭建思路)
saas平台技术搭建思路
saas系统
SaaS平台是运营saas软件的平台。SaaS提供商为企业搭建信息化所需要的所有网络基础设施及软件、硬件运作平台,并负责所有前期的实施、后期的维护等一系列服务,企业无需购买软硬件、建设机房、招聘IT人员,即可通过互联网使用信息系统。
SaaS 是一种软件布局模型,其应用专为网络交付而设计,便于用户通过互联网托管、部署及接入。
saas实现
企业级 服务是指 为目 标用 户 为 企业 的客户群 体 提供 的 服务, 那 么像 淘 金云 客 服 这样 的 客 服 平台 , 是基于 客服 外包这 个 传 统 需 求 之 上,合 理 分 配
saas架构及关键技术
SaaS平台架构,可SaaS平台架构CRM,ERP,OA,行业软件等企业应用,含报表,表单流程,工作流等模块,支持SaaS模式,页面运用,多数据库,前后端分离等功能.saas平台架构之呈现层 saas平台架构的呈现层可使用的客户端有浏览器或本地客户端.
如果是浏览器则...saas平台架构之调度层 saas平台架构的调度层体现分布式系统的特性之一.调度层首先负责识别并通过...saas平台架构之业务层 saas平台架构的业务层负责接收调度层转发过来的请求...
saas平台架构最成熟的架构
云分为laas,paas,saas三层架构,saas软件即服务,主要是应用层。
saas平台技术架构
这个世界变化实在是快,各种新名词层出不穷,让人眼花缭乱。IT业更是不甘落后,不断发明出各种新名词、新概念,让企业摸不着头脑。
目前大大小小的软件公司都在谈B/S,C/S,SaaS,并都极力鼓吹自己所采用架构的好处,极力数落其它架构的种种不好,让人分不清到底哪种观点是正确的。事实上事情没有这么复杂,透过现象看本质,你会恍然大悟,原来很多东西只不过新瓶装老酒而已。
B/S(Browser/Server):浏览器/服务器架构,如果你所用的软件是通过浏览器来操作的,那这个软件就是B/S架构,最典型的就是网上银行。那么,B/S是不是一定要上网才能使用?当然不是,B/S架构的软件可以安装在局域网或个人电脑上,通过在IIS中建立站点来使用。所以,抛开种种表面现象,B/S最基本的特征就是通过浏览器来使用。
C/S(Client/Server):客户端/服务器架构,如果你所用的软件是要通过点击桌面上的某个图标来运行,或者在使用之前一定要安装,就是C/S架构了,典型的比如Office办公软件就可以看作是C/S架构。C/S架构的软件当然也能和B/S架构的软件一样,通过互联网来共享数据,但无论C/S软件的网络功能多强,在每台要使用此软件的电脑上,是一定要安装客户端的。所以,C/S架构最基本的特征就是有多少台电脑要使用,就得安装多少个客户端。
SaaS(Soft as a Service):软件即服务,SaaS不是一种软件架构,而是一种软件销售方式。SaaS的软件是采用B/S架构,但通过对每个使用者收取年租费或月租费来销售。网易163收费邮箱就可以看作是典型的SaaS模式:通过浏览器来访问,大家使用同一个登录页面和登录地址,每个人有自己的登录用户名和密码,每年要缴费,邮件数据统一放在网易的服务器上,你不能把网易邮箱搬到自己公司服务器上,如果某一天你不想续费了,对不起,你的邮件就拿不回来了。如果某一天网易要维护服务器,那所有用户这一天都不能登录系统收发邮件。
以上说明了这三个名词的基本区别。至于其它的诸如安全性、便利性、经济性,只能看客户自己的选择了。B/S架构最为人诟病的就是安全性,但如果真的安全性很差,还有人敢用网上银行吗?何况一个软件的安全性与架构、开发语言并无多大关联,而是与软件开发企业的实力、程序员的素质和软件使用者的安全意识紧密相关!SaaS的最大卖点就是便宜,这一点企业也可以算一笔帐:终身的租费和一次性的缴费到底哪个更划算?而且财务数据和客户信息往往是一个企业的核心机密,将这些至关重要的核心数据放在提供SaaS服务的第三方服务器上,对于大部分企业来说是无法接受的。
飞速E3采用B/S架构,正是考虑到了B/S架构的种种优点:
1、采用B/S架构,无需在每台电脑上安装客户端,便于部署。
2、采用B/S架构,企业可以把核心数据放在自己公司服务器上,没有后顾之忧。
3、采用B/S架构,可以利用企业已有网站的域名和服务器,节省了企业投资。
4、利用浏览器来访问,简单方便,随时随地使用,可以确保企业确实把软件用起来。
5、采用软件费用一次性收取、服务费由客户自选的方式,让企业消费的明明白白。
6、数据单独存放,登录地址自定,托管或自管可选
saas平台技术搭建思路有哪些
网校搭建,其实非常简单,除了自己找人研发的那种方式外,就是找第三方网校系统平台,利用他们的saas平台去搭建,这种搭建方式是性价比最高的,很多中小型的企业都在用这种方法去搭建网校,只需要5分钟就可以拥有自己的网校了,对了,不要听信什么免费的网校系统,那些所谓的免费的都是阉割版,很多功能都没有的!如果你真的想搭建网校最好弄个正常版本的,其中的利弊,不用我多说了。至于网校系统的选择,有很多超时代(大黄蜂云课堂)是做加密软件出身的,对于网校系统的加密性还是挺有保证的,毕竟做网校最怕的就是视频流传。
saas模式部署
应该是saas系统,软件即服务系统
SaaS指的是软件即服务,saas系统指的是“软件即服务系统”,即该系统可以通过网络提供软件服务。
SaaS系统的平台供应商将应用软件统一部署在自己的服务器上,客户可以根据实际需求,通过互联网向厂商定购所需的应用软件服务,并按定购的服务多少和时间长短向厂商支付费用,并通过互联网获得Saas平台供应商提供的服务。其应用软件有免费、付费和增值三种模式。
saas平台的搭建
现在都用这家的软件,主要是不要钱,功能还很强大,点播,直播,一对一,教务管理,购物车付款系统,在线题库等等
saas平台技术搭建思路和方法
云平台不知道题主说的是哪种? 一般云计算平台分为常见的一下类型:
IaaS云说的是基础设施即服务,这种云计算平台提供的是IT领域的基础计算资源,比如: 计算、内存,存储、网络等。这种云平台一般底层通过虚拟化(kvm,xen,exsi)技术做底层资源的抽象整合,然后通过虚拟机的形式提供给用户一个完整的操作系统环境。典型的产品有: 开源的OpenStack、CloudStack。商业的Vmware公司的vsphere等。公有云产品就很多了: 阿里云,腾讯云,百度云,ucloud,青云,滴滴云,AWS等。
2. PaaS云说的是平台即服务,这种云计算平台与IaaS平台最大的差别在于,IaaS云只是提供了基础的计算存储网络等资源,应用运行的环境需要专门的应用运维工程师去部署和运维环境,而PaaS云不仅提供了计算等基础资源外,还提供了runtime以及中间件服务。最直观的体验就是早期的京东JAE服务,用法很简单,只需要上传一个PHP源码压缩包,应用就可以直接运行了。简单的来说PaaS云让用户只关注业务不需要关注资源和runtime以及中间件的一种云平台。典型的产品:pivotal cloudfoundray,IBM bluemix, VMware PKS。
3. SaaS云说的是软件即服务,相对于前两种云比较来看个人感觉最大的区别在于,SaaS服务直接面向普通用户的,IaaS云面向运维工程师降低运维工程师管理硬件基础设施提高运维的效率,PaaS云面向开发者快速提供开发环境以及部署环境等,这两种云都不是直接面向普通用户的,都是面向IT人员。这种一般来说比较典型产品就是saleforce,石墨文档等。
以上是三种云计算的典型分类方法。
但是随着近些年来的容器技术的发展,也衍生出来更多细化的分类:
比如: CaaS云,容器即服务。FaaS 函数即服务等等。
对于这三种云平台来说部署的方式各不相同,技术难度也不一样。需要明确自己的使用场景,然后确定自己使用的类型。
对于搭建云平台技术。现在一般推荐使用docker + k8s的方式去构建一个mini PaaS平台。本人从事云计算运维开发多年,以上是我的回答。
本网站文章仅供交流学习 ,不作为商用, 版权归属原作者,部分文章推送时未能及时与原作者取得联系,若来源标注错误或侵犯到您的权益烦请告知,我们将立即删除.